Pinpoint Test An: DTC B19A5

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2010 Lincoln MKX and 2010 Ford Edge.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
NOTE: When taking measurements at Dual Climate Controlled Seat Module (DCSM) harness connectors, do not insert the electrical probes into the female connector pins. Inserting the probes into connector pins can cause intermittent or open electrical connections after reassembly resulting in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) and system failure. Touching the tip of these connector pins is recommended instead.
NOTE: The air bag warning indicator illuminates when the correct Restraints Control Module (RCM) fuse is removed and the ignition switch is ON.
NOTE: The Supplemental Restraint System (SRS) must be fully operational and free of faults before releasing the vehicle to the customer.
  1. AN1 CHECK CUSHION TED BLOWER SPEED CONTROL CIRCUIT VHS23 (BN/BU) FOR A SHORT TO GROUND 
    • Ignition OFF.
    • Depower the SRS  . Refer to S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M (SRS) DEPOWERING AND REPOWERING .
    • Disconnect: Passenger Seat Side Air Bag C327.
    • Disconnect: DCSM  C3036c.
    • Disconnect: Cushion TED  C3328.
    • Measure the resistance between DCSM  C3036c-3, circuit VHS23 (BN/BU), harness side and ground.
      Fig 1: Measuring Resistance Between DCSM C3036c-3, Circuit VHS23 (BN/BU), Harness Side And Ground
      G06504290Courtesy of FORD MOTOR CO.
    • Is the resistance greater than 10,000 ohms? 
  2. AN2 CHECK CUSHION TED BLOWER SPEED CONTROL CIRCUIT VHS23 (BN/BU) AND BLOWER GROUND CIRCUIT RHS08 (VT/WH) FOR A SHORT TOGETHER 
    • Measure the resistance between DCSM  C3036c-3, circuit VHS23 (BN/BU), harness side and C3036c-7, circuit RHS08 (VT/WH), harness side.
      Fig 2: Measuring Resistance Between DCSM C3036c-3, Circuit VHS23 (BN/BU), Harness Side And C3036c-7, Circuit RHS08 (VT/WH)
      G06134427Courtesy of FORD MOTOR CO.
    • Is the resistance greater than 10,000 ohms? 
  3. AN3 DETERMINE CUSHION TED OR DCSM FAILURE 
    • Remove the cushion TED  from the passenger seat. Refer to SEAT CUSHION THERMO-ELECTRIC DEVICE .
    • Remove the cushion TED  from the driver seat and install it on the passenger seat.
    • Connect: Cushion TED  C3328.
    • Connect: Dual Climate Controlled Seat Module (DCSM) C3036c.
    • WARNING: Make sure no one is in the vehicle and there is nothing blocking or placed in front of any air bag module when the battery is connected. Failure to follow these instructions may result in serious personal injury in the event of an accidental deployment.
    • Connect the battery ground cable. Refer to BATTERY, MOUNTING AND CABLES .
    • Start the engine and check operation of the passenger seat climate controlled seat system.
    • Does the seat operate with the TED from the other seat installed?
